- The distance between Ottawa, Ks, Usa and Comfort Cove, Nf, Canada is approximately 1,520 km or 945 mi.
- To reach Ottawa, Ks in this distance one would set out from Comfort Cove, Nf bearing 230.7° or SW and follow the great circles arc to approach Ottawa, Ks bearing 221.2° or SW .
- Ottawa, Ks has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a) whereas Comfort Cove, Nf has a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b).
- Ottawa, Ks is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ome whereas Comfort Cove, Nf is in or near the boreal wet forest biome.
- The average temperature is 9.5 °C (17.1°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 4.1 °C (7.4°F) more in Ottawa, Ks. The continentality subtype is truly continental as opposed to subcontinental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 156.2 mm (6.1 in) less which is equivalent to 156.2 l/m² (3.83 US gal/ft²) or 1,562,000 l/ha (166,988 US gal/ac) less. About 6/7 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 9.5° higher in Ottawa, Ks than in Comfort Cove, Nf.
